it's a little heated sensor element with a cooled one behind it. The computer maintains it at a certain temperature (around 300 degrees) and depending on how hard it has to work to keep it warm (I.E. flooring it = more air past it = cools off more) it will tell the computer more air is coming in. Definitely a part you want to keep safe and clean, and is very delicate.

I thought it worked by measuring how much the element was cooling rather than trying to keep it the same temp, but either way is the same idea. the same wire at two different temperatures will have a difference electrical resistance, so they can figure out how much air is going into the intake by using the air temp and the resistance (or input power) of the wire to figure out how much air is going in.
